Arsenal’s excellent recruitment in recent years was one of the factors that allowed them to challenge Man City for the Premier League title last season.
Since Edu started controlling the strings, the Gunners have seldom ever missed in the market. The Brazilian has also signed fellow countrymen with particularly significant success.
North London has seen roaring successes like Gabriel Magalhaes, Gabriel Martinelli, and Gabriel Jesus. Given that Martinelli was acquired directly from Brazilian club Ituano for just £6 million, he is perhaps the best of the bunch.
According to recent Italian reports, Edu was attempting to repeat himself after assessing Gremio player Bitello.
The 23-year-old right-footer usually plays in center midfield, although he is also capable of filling in on the right wing.
According to TuttoMercatoWeb, Bitello has 16 goals in 86 games for Gremio, and the Gunners were seriously considering signing him.
The identities of the teams vying with Arsenal for the player have now been disclosed in a new 90min update. But the team that is predicted to win is the Gunners.
First, Monaco, FC Porto, and Zenit St. Petersburg will compete in the 90-minute report.
However, Arsenal is now working on the deal and is “confident” that they will sign the Brazilian.
The £8.5 million asking price for Gremio is rather low. Given the comparable price tags, a transfer would consequently have another similarity to Martinelli’s.
According to the player’s perspective, Bitello is “ready to transfer continents.” In other words, he would be okay with joining Arsenal and moving from South America to Europe.
According to reports, Edu himself selected Bitello as a transfer target. Few would wager against Bitello being a success if the move goes through given the Arsenal manager’s good track record with buying Brazilian players in particular.
